Belgium’s Foreign Minister condemned an overnight Israeli air strike on an UN-run school in Gaza and called for an immediate ceasefire. “The devastating air strike on a UNRWA school in Gaza is an appalling and unacceptable act of violence. All parties must respect civilian infrastructure,” Hadja Lahbib wrote on X. The school was sheltering hundreds of people when it was struck at 2.15am local time, according to Palestinian media.
